In the Hour of Trial

Author: J. Montgomery Hymnal: Hallowed Hymns, New and Old #250 (1908) Lyrics: 1 In the hour of trial, Jesus, plead for me, Lest, by base denial, I depart from Thee; When Thou seest me waver, With a look recall; Nor for fear or favor, Suffer me to fall. 2 Should Thy mercy send me Sorrow, toil, or woe; Or should pain attend me On my path below; Grant that I may never Fail Thy hand to see; Grant that I may ever Cast my care on Thee. 3 When, in dust and ashes, To the grave I sink, While heav'n's glory flashes O'er the shelving brink, On Thy truth relying Thro' that mortal strife, Lord, receive me, dying, To eternal life. Topics: Temptation-Trial Languages: English Tune Title: PENITENCE
